What is a Textured Top Haircut?

A textured top haircut features short sides and back, paired with a longer, textured top section that adds volume and movement to the hair. The key characteristic of this haircut is the texture on the top, achieved by cutting the hair with layers to create dimension and flow. The sides are typically faded, tapered, or simply kept short, making the textured top the focal point of the haircut.

The textured top haircut can vary in length, ranging from a subtle, slightly longer top to a more dramatic, voluminous finish. It can also be paired with various fade styles, such as a low fade, high fade, or even a buzzed fade, depending on your preferences.

How to Get the Perfect Textured Top Haircut

Achieving the textured top haircut requires the right technique and tools. Here’s how to get the look:

Choose the Right Length for the Top

  • Decide how long you want the top to be. The length can vary based on your personal preference. A slightly longer top gives more volume, while a shorter textured top offers a cleaner, more defined look.

Decide on the Sides and Back

  • The sides and back are typically short, so you can choose a fade or tapered look, or even keep the sides buzzed for a more uniform appearance.
  • A fade adds contrast between the top and sides, while a taper provides a smoother transition from the top to the sides.

Layer the Top

  • Your barber or stylist will use scissors to layer the hair on the top of your head to create texture. The layering helps to add volume and movement to your hair.
  • The key is to create a more messy, tousled look on top, which can be achieved by varying the length of the layers slightly to avoid a uniform finish.

Clean Up the Edges

  • After the hair on top is cut to the desired length and texture, the barber will clean up the edges around the hairline, ears, and neckline to give the cut a clean, polished appearance.

Style the Top

  • To style the textured top, use a light to medium-hold styling cream, wax, or pomade. Apply the product to slightly damp hair and work it through the layers for definition.

  • Use your fingers or a comb to create texture, lifting the hair at the roots to add volume and movement.

How to Style a Textured Top Haircut

The beauty of the textured top haircut lies in its versatility. Depending on your mood or the occasion, you can style your hair in different ways:

Messy, Tousled Look

  • For a more relaxed, casual style, use a texturizing spray or light styling cream. Scrunch the hair with your fingers to create volume and a tousled finish. This style works great for a laid-back, effortless look.

Polished, Slicked-Back Look

  • If you prefer a more refined style, use a medium-hold pomade to slick back the top. Comb through the hair to keep it in place and add a shine for a sleek, professional appearance.

Voluminous Style

  • For a voluminous style, apply volumizing mousse to damp hair and blow-dry the top section while lifting it at the roots. This will give your hair extra height and fullness, perfect for a night out or special event.

Side-Parted Textured Look

  • If you prefer a more structured look, create a side part and comb the hair to one side. Use a bit of pomade or gel to keep the hair in place while maintaining the natural texture and movement.

How to Maintain Your Textured Top Haircut

To keep your textured top haircut looking fresh and sharp, follow these maintenance tips:

  • Trim Regularly: The top should be trimmed every 4-6 weeks to maintain the texture and shape. The sides will need a touch-up every 2-3 weeks if you’ve opted for a fade or taper.

  • Use the Right Products: For the best results, use products designed for textured hair, such as texturizing sprays, beach wave sprays, or light-hold pomades to maintain volume and definition.

  • Hydrate Your Hair: Use a moisturizing shampoo and conditioner to keep your hair healthy and prevent dryness, especially if you’re using styling products frequently.

FAQs

How often should I trim my textured top haircut?

Trim your textured top haircut every 4-6 weeks to keep the length and texture intact, and the sides neat.

Can I wear the textured top haircut for formal events?

Yes! The textured top haircut is versatile and can be styled to look sleek and polished for formal events or kept casual for a more laid-back vibe.

How can I add more texture to my hair?

Use texturizing spray, sea salt spray, or a light styling cream to enhance the natural texture and volume of your hair.

Is a textured top haircut low maintenance?

Yes! While it requires occasional trims to keep the style fresh, the textured top is generally easy to maintain compared to longer, more intricate styles.
